전체 글(278)
-
[챕터 1-2] 기본 네이티브 앱
파워쉘 실행 후 작업공간 디렉토리로 이동 (C:\dev\) npm config set save-exact=true react-native init FirstApp (*) 이 부분에서 시간이 꽤 걸림. 중지되어있는 화면처럼 보일 수 있으나, 기다릴 것. 약 30분에서 40분정도.. cd FirstApp 파워쉘 npx react-native run-android [오류 발생시] Unable to load script. Make sure youre dither running a Metro server > 주로 NodeJS 버젼에 의한 문제일 확률이 큼. 기본 결과화면
2020.02.20 -
[챕터 1-1] 리액트 네이티브 개발환경 설치 및 설정
윈도우 개발 환경 설정 윈도우(Windows)에서 리액트 네이티브를 개발하기 위해서는 노드, 파이썬(Python), 안드로이드 스튜디오 등을 설치해야 한다. 1. 초코렛티 설치 https://chocolatey.org/ Chocolatey - The package manager for Windows Chocolatey is software management automation for Windows that wraps installers, executables, zips, and scripts into compiled packages. Chocolatey integrates w/SCCM, Puppet, Chef, etc. Chocolatey is trusted by businesses to manage ..
2020.02.20 -
[챕터 2-10-4] 연락처 프로필 정보 조회
결과화면 연락처 불러오기 버튼 클릭 sako 프로필 선택 프로젝트명 : MyContacts MainActivity.java 더보기 package org.minokuma.mycontacts; import androidx.annotation.Nullable; import androidx.appcompat.app.AppCompatActivity; import android.content.Intent; import android.os.Bundle; import android.provider.ContactsContract; import android.view.View; import android.widget.Button; import android.widget.TextView; public class MainAc..
2020.02.19 -
[챕터 2-10-3] 앨범
결과화면 이미지 선택 버튼 클릭 시 앨범 선택 이미지 지정 프로젝트명 : MyAlbum 이미지 뷰 레이아웃 : match parent MainActivity.java 더보기 package org.minokuma.myalbum; import androidx.annotation.Nullable; import androidx.appcompat.app.AppCompatActivity; import android.content.Intent; import android.os.Bundle; import android.view.View; import android.widget.Button; import android.widget.ImageView; public class MainActivity extends AppCo..
2020.02.19 -
[챕터 2-10-2] 프로바이더
결과화면 INSERT 후 QUERY UPDATE 후 QUERY DELETE 후 QUERY 결과 프로젝트명 : MyProvider 하위 리니어레이아웃 - 레이아웃 높이 : wrap_content MainActivity.java 더보기 package org.minokuma.myprovider; import androidx.appcompat.app.AppCompatActivity; import android.os.Bundle; import android.view.View; import android.widget.Button; import android.widget.TextView; public class MainActivity extends AppCompatActivity { TextView textView;..
2020.02.19 -
[챕터 2-10-1] SQLite 데이터베이스
결과화면 생성할 DB명 : minodb 생성할 테이블명 : customer 입력 후 DB 생성 버튼과 테이블 생성 버튼 클릭해서 진행 데이터 조회 버튼 클릭 시, customer 테이블의 데이터 조회해서 출력됨 레코드 추가 버튼 클릭 후 조회하면 3개의 레코드 확인 프로젝트명 : MyDatabase 각 하위 리니어레이아웃 - 레이아웃 높이 : wrap_content MainActivity.java 더보기 package org.minokuma.mydatabase; import androidx.appcompat.app.AppCompatActivity; import android.database.Cursor; import android.database.sqlite.SQLiteDatabase; import an..
2020.02.19